S2BlazeDS利用しての開発。Tomcat6にCoolDeployできずはまり中(解決)
(昨日の続き)
エラーを出すと思われるコンポーネントを完全に削ってみた。クリーンビルド、Tomcat起動。
致命的: StandardWrapper.Throwable
java.lang.NoClassDefFoundError: org/jgroups/MembershipListener
convention.diconでなく、customizer.diconに書いた方のサービスの登録かと思い一度定義を外し、クリーンビルド、Tomcat起動。
致命的: StandardWrapper.Throwable
java.lang.NoClassDefFoundError: org/jgroups/MembershipListener
作成したflex用パッケージは、
flex.entity
flex.service
と2つのサブパッケージがあるが、convention.diconには、
"flex"
とルート宣言してた。ここを
"flex.service"
"flex.entity"
としてみた。なんと、エラーが出なくなった!結局、jgroupsも、geronimo-jmsもWEB-INF/lib下に置く必要ないようだ!?おお。夢でも見てるのか?
ちょっと寝てからちゃんと動くかどうかはじっくりやってみますわ。。ん?ああっそーか、flexではじめちゃったらAdobe Flexパッケージ全部ひっぱってこようとしちゃうじゃないの!
だからダメだったのかorz..なんて初歩的な。。
でもいい勉強になりました。